What Goes In

  • 1 cup (228g) all-purpose flour – The foundation of our cookies.
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da – Helps the cookies rise and achieve that perfect soft texture.
  • 1 teaspoon kosher salt – Balances the sweetness and enhances the flavors.
  • 1 cup (113g) unsalted butter, room temperature – Provides richness and moisture.
  • 1 cup (160g) light brown sugar – Adds depth of flavor and chewiness.
  • 1/2 cup (50g) granulated sugar – Contributes to the cookie’s crisp edges.
  • 1 egg – Binds the ingredients together and adds richness.
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ract – Infuses the cookies with warm, sweet notes.
  • 1 cup (312g) M&M candies (or a combination of M&Ms and chocolate chips) – The star ingredient that adds color and sweetness.

Step-by-Step: Super Soft and Chewy M&M Cookies

Easy Super Soft and Chewy M&M Cookies recipe photo

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Start by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C). This ensures that your cookies bake evenly.

Step 2: Prepare Your Baking Sheet

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. This will prevent the cookies from sticking and make for easy cleanup.

Step 3: Mix Dry Ingredients

In a medium b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, and kosher salt. Set this mixture aside.

Step 4: Cream Butter and Sugars

In a large mixing bowl, combine the room temperature unsalted butter, light brown sugar, and granulated sugar. Using a hand mixer or a stand mixer, beat the mixture on medium speed until it’s creamy and light in color, about 2-3 minutes.

Step 5: Add Egg and Vanilla

Add the egg and vanilla extract to the butter-sugar mixture. Beat until well combined.

Step 6: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, mixing on low speed until just comb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can lead to tougher cookies.

Step 7: Fold in M&Ms

Using a spatula, gently fold in the M&M candies (and chocolate chips if you’re using them). Make sure they are evenly distributed throughout the dough.

Step 8: Scoop the Dough

Using a cookie scoop or a tablespoon, drop rounded balls of cookie dough onto the prepared baking sheet, leaving enough space between each cookie for spreading.

Step 9: Bake

Bake in the preheated oven for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den. The centers may look slightly underbaked, but they will continue to cook as they cool.

Step 10: Cool and Enjoy

Remove the cookies from the oven and let them c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ely. Enjoy your Super Soft and Chewy M&M Cookies warm or store them for later!

Fit It to Your Goals

  • Gluten-Free Option: Substitute the all-purpose flour with a 1:1 gluten-free baking blend.
  • Lower Sugar: Use a sugar substitute for a lower-calorie version.
  • Mix It Up: Swap M&Ms for nuts or dried fruit for a different flavor profile.
  • Vegan Version: Use vegan butter and replace the egg with a flax egg (1 tablespoon ground flaxseed mixed with 2.5 tablespoons water).

Mistakes Even Pros Make

  • Overmixing the dough can lead to tough cookies instead of soft and chewy ones.
  • Using cold butter instead of room temperature can impact the texture.
  • Not measuring the flour correctly can result in dry cookies.
  • Baking too long can make the cookies hard instead of soft and chewy.

Shelf Life & Storage

These Super Soft and Chewy M&M Cookies can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. For longer storage, consider freezing them. To freeze, place the cookies in a single layer in a freezer-safe container, separating layers with parchment paper. They can be frozen for up to three months. When you’re ready to enjoy, simply let them thaw at room temperature or warm them in the microwave for a few seconds!

Common Qs About Super Soft and Chewy M&M Cookies

Can I use different types of M&Ms in this recipe?

Absolutely! Feel free to mix and match different varieties of M&Ms, or even use chocolate chips for a variation.

What if I don’t have light brown sugar?

If you don’t have light brown sugar, you can use granulated sugar, but the cookies may not be as chewy. Alternatively, you can make your own brown sugar by mixing granulated sugar with a bit of molasses.

How do I know when the cookies are done baking?

The cookies should be lightly golden around the edges and still soft in the center. They will continue to firm up as they cool.

Can I make the dough ahead of time?

Yes! You can prepare the dough in advance and refrigerate it for up to 3 days before baking. Just let it sit at room temperature for about 10-15 minutes before scooping and baking.
